Main Ingredients for Crispy Chili Beef & Shrimp Noodles Recipe

Beef Strips

For this recipe, you’ll need 250 grams of thinly sliced beef strips. Choose cuts like sirloin or flank steak for tenderness. Make sure to slice against the grain for optimal texture. Marinating the beef in soy sauce and cornstarch will not only add flavor but also help achieve that crispy exterior during cooking.

Shrimp

Use about 200 grams of large shrimp, peeled and deveined. Fresh or frozen shrimp both work well; however, if using frozen shrimp, ensure they are completely thawed before cooking. The shrimp will cook quickly and should be added towards the end of the stir-fry process for juicy results.

Egg Noodles

You will require approximately 200 grams of egg noodles which provide a hearty base for our dish. These noodles are perfect as they absorb flavors beautifully while holding up well during cooking. If egg noodles are unavailable, feel free to substitute with rice noodles or even spaghetti in a pinch.

Bell Peppers

Two medium-sized bell peppers (red and green) add color and crunch to your dish. Slice them into thin strips so they cook evenly during the stir-fry process. They not only enhance visual appeal but also provide additional vitamins and minerals.

Garlic

A couple of cloves of minced garlic (about two teaspoons) is essential for adding depth of flavor. Garlic complements both beef and shrimp beautifully, infusing them with aromatic goodness as they cook.

Soy Sauce

Use three tablespoons of soy sauce as part of your marinade and sauce mixture. It adds saltiness and umami flavor that balances out the heat from the chili sauce.

Chili Sauce

For heat lovers, one tablespoon of chili sauce brings that spicy kick we love in Asian cuisine. Adjust according to your spice tolerance; you can always add more later if desired!

Cornstarch

A tablespoon of cornstarch is crucial for creating that crispy coating on both the beef and shrimp during frying. This ingredient helps lock in moisture while giving a lovely crunch.

How to Prepare Crispy Chili Beef & Shrimp Noodles Recipe

Step 1: Marinate the Meat

Start by marinating your beef strips in a bowl with one tablespoon each of soy sauce and cornstarch along with a pinch of salt and pepper for about 15 minutes. This step is important as it ensures maximum flavor absorption while helping create that desirable crispy texture when cooked later on. Meanwhile, you can prepare your other ingredients by chopping vegetables and getting everything ready for quick assembly later.

Step 2: Cook the Noodles

Boil water in a large pot over high heat then add your egg noodles once it’s at a rolling boil. Cook according to package instructions until al dente—usually around 4-6 minutes depending on thickness—then drain them thoroughly once done. Rinse under cold water briefly to stop further cooking; set aside until needed later in the stir-fry process.

Step 3: Stir-Fry

Heat two tablespoons of o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ering hot; then carefully add marinated beef strips into the pan without overcrowding it too much at once (you may need to do batches). Allow them time to sear nicely before flipping them over—this ensures crispness! After about two minutes on each side or until browned nicely remove from skillet onto paper towels allowing excess grease absorption whilst repeating steps if necessary until all meat has been cooked properly.

Step 4: Add Vegetables & Shrimp

With residual oil still hot leftover from frying meat earlier; toss minced garlic into skillet followed immediately by sliced bell peppers stirring vigorously so everything gets coated evenly before adding peeled shrimp into mix too! Cook together continuously stirring until shrimp turns opaque—this usually takes about three minutes total time depending upon thickness—then return previously cooked beef back into pan combining all ingredients thoroughly ensuring uniform distribution throughout dish overall!

Mistakes to Avoid for Crispy Chili Beef & Shrimp Noodles Recipe

Overcooking the Protein

One of the most common mistakes in preparing the Crispy Chili Beef & Shrimp Noodles Recipe is overcooking the protein. Both beef and shrimp require precise cooking times to maintain their texture and flavor. Overcooked beef becomes tough and chewy while shrimp can turn rubbery. To prevent this, ensure that your beef is sliced thinly against the grain for even cooking, and marinate it properly beforehand. When cooking shrimp, keep an eye on them; they cook quickly and should be removed from heat as soon as they turn pink and opaque. This careful attention during cooking will yield tender protein that complements the noodles perfectly.

Ignoring Fresh Ingredients

Another mistake to avoid when making this dish is using stale or low-quality ingredients. Fresh vegetables, herbs, and proteins significantly enhance the overall flavor of your Crispy Chili Beef & Shrimp Noodles. Always choose fresh bell peppers, scallions, and garlic. These ingredients contribute not only to taste but also to texture and presentation. Using wilted vegetables or expired proteins can lead to a bland or unappetizing dish. Regularly check your pantry for freshness of sauces like soy sauce or chili paste, as these are integral to achieving that bold flavor profile.

Not Balancing Flavors

Failing to balance flavors is a crucial mistake when preparing any Asian-inspired dish, including the Crispy Chili Beef & Shrimp Noodles Recipe. The ideal combination of spicy, sweet, salty, and umami is essential for a well-rounded meal. If you find your dish leaning too much towards one flavor profile, consider adjusting by adding a dash of sugar for sweetness or more soy sauce for saltiness. A splash of lime juice can also help brighten up the dish if it feels too heavy. Tasting as you go ensures that you achieve the perfect balance for your palate.

Crispy Chili Beef & Shrimp Noodles – A Flavor Explosion


  • Author: Charlotte Flores
  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Description

A delightful fusion of crispy beef, succulent shrimp, and stir-fried vegetables tossed with egg noodles in a spicy chili soy sauce. Perfect for weeknight dinners or when craving a flavorful Asian-inspired dish.

 


Ingredients

Scale
  • 250g beef strips (sirloin or flank, thinly sliced)
  • 200g large shrimp (peeled and deveined)
  • 200g egg noodles
  • 2 medium bell peppers (red and green, sliced)
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 3 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tbsp chili sauce
  • 1 tbsp cornstarch
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 2 tbsp oil, for frying

Instructions

  1. Marinate the Beef:
    Marinate beef strips with 1 tbsp soy sauce, 1 tbsp cornstarch, salt, and pepper for 15 minutes.
  2. Cook the Noodles:
    Boil noodles until al dente (4-6 minutes). Drain, rinse with cold water, and set aside.
  3. Stir-Fry Beef:
    Heat oil in a skillet, fry marinated beef in batches until crispy (about 2 minutes per side). Remove and set aside.
  4. Cook Vegetables & Shrimp:
    In the same skillet, sauté garlic and bell peppers for 2 minutes. Add shrimp and cook until pink and opaque (3 minutes).
  5. Combine and Sauce:
    Return beef to the skillet. Mix soy sauce and chili sauce in a bowl and pour over the stir-fry. Toss in cooked noodles, mix well, and serve hot.

Notes

  • Adjust chili sauce based on your spice tolerance.
  • Substitute chicken or tofu for shrimp and beef if desired.
  • Add a splash of lime juice for extra zing!
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20 minutes
